Final version of floor:
Floor sort of looks like a biker mama’s tattoos, but painting it on the floor will soften the harshness of some things. Overall I used a dark red fading to black here and there, to mimic the theatre house. The thorny vines will wind around upstage. New photos of model with a ceiling piece below. The placements of the moving walls is only a suggestion and will change throughout the process. The chandelier is a wild leafy thing, see photo at the bottom of this page.
